Works now.. Just didn't get around to posting.


1 of 2 Things..

Either Coppermine doesn't like suEXEC or It was configured wrong.   I added freetype to the GD libary and when i recomplied apache.. I inadvertently added suEXEC.  Once it was removed.. everything was fine.
